Daredevil #35
“Daredevil Dies First!”
Trapster seeks legal advice from Nelson and Murdock on the penalty for murdering Daredevil. After a pitched battle with D.D. in which the villain believes the hero vanquished, Trapster heads to the Baxter Building to take on the F.F. but finds Invisible Girl the only one home.
